Second Chances


Torn from love's warm flesh.
Thrown upon the floor
Of carelessness.
Held up before injured,
Untrusting eyes.
A million diamond memories.

Dreams in emerald;
Tears of ruby and sapphire
Embedded in broken trust.
Disappointments gleam dully
From mirrored facets.
Reflection inside reflection,
Pain inside fear.

Discarded jewels of
Yesterday reforged, redeemed.
Tarnished band of betrayal
Melts into golden hope.
Tempered in soft words,
Lilting, rainbow laughter
Sparkles in gilt claws
Of perfectly wrought kindness.

Newly beheld,
Beauty renewed.
Similar but unique.
Precious. Beauty quietly
Awaiting courage
To place it upon
Love's second chance.
